Leon
|
3c733b6691
|
resolve todo, remove asserts, add duplicate checks and make sure they pass
|
2019-06-17 14:03:59 +02:00 |
|
Leon
|
e5b9b13160
|
rename impl to leaktime
|
2019-06-16 17:01:29 +02:00 |
|
Leon
|
db99d3ec09
|
more msvc complaints
|
2019-06-14 16:07:31 +02:00 |
|
Leon
|
e353081cc2
|
fix msvc warnings
|
2019-06-14 15:04:30 +02:00 |
|
Leon
|
bf0aca644e
|
avoid global state by including 2nd round threshold in secret key
|
2019-06-14 14:23:58 +02:00 |
|
Leon
|
5a4b7f24a3
|
(de)serialization instead of pointer casts
|
2019-06-12 15:33:20 +02:00 |
|
Leon
|
6811a40527
|
move implementations of functions to .c files
|
2019-06-11 22:50:33 +02:00 |
|
Leon
|
9e3f973f56
|
define a constant for max number of rng bytes, remove unnecessary check
|
2019-06-11 21:45:39 +02:00 |
|
Leon
|
889a1f1e53
|
fix mvsc warning
|
2019-06-11 17:09:28 +02:00 |
|
Leon
|
9c2449387a
|
include stdint in api
|
2019-06-11 16:50:38 +02:00 |
|
Leon
|
26dad0211d
|
remove unused functions
|
2019-06-11 16:39:41 +02:00 |
|
Leon
|
98e643e5c7
|
use size_t for index in aes xof buffer and not for index of digits
|
2019-06-11 16:20:31 +02:00 |
|
Leon
|
e5da5da9a6
|
use uint8_t in api
|
2019-06-11 16:18:21 +02:00 |
|
Leon
|
3caad74525
|
variable declarations at the beginning, namespace extern variables
|
2019-06-11 14:21:49 +02:00 |
|
Leon
|
737cb1bb2e
|
add ledakemlt32
|
2019-06-10 20:42:31 +02:00 |
|
Leon
|
32b3a97809
|
add sha3_384
|
2019-06-10 20:40:49 +02:00 |
|
leonbotros
|
4f97fa82b6
|
Merge pull request #1 from PQClean/master
update fork
|
2019-06-10 18:56:06 +02:00 |
|
Leon
|
6aafab57ef
|
add ledakemlt52
|
2019-06-10 18:57:26 +02:00 |
|
Matthias J. Kannwischer
|
24566014fa
|
Merge pull request #183 from Ko-/cshake
Add cSHAKE{128,256} to common
|
2019-06-07 09:35:25 -05:00 |
|
Leon
|
c0aa560186
|
remove commented code, update license
|
2019-06-07 15:07:22 +02:00 |
|
Leon
|
48912d76ff
|
msvc warning + removing commented code
|
2019-06-07 13:57:15 +02:00 |
|
Ko-
|
cf88fb781e
|
Satisfy linter
|
2019-06-07 13:46:31 +02:00 |
|
Leon
|
e4add57844
|
more cleaning
|
2019-06-07 13:40:02 +02:00 |
|
Leon
|
6f31e7e4c2
|
serialize error_vector before hashing instead of pointer cast
|
2019-06-07 13:02:25 +02:00 |
|
Ko-
|
eca0ebd374
|
Add test for functions from SP800-185.
|
2019-06-07 11:46:55 +02:00 |
|
Ko-
|
db7d3deb03
|
Add cSHAKE{128,256} to common.
|
2019-06-07 11:43:52 +02:00 |
|
Douglas Stebila
|
2f3c0bd4ec
|
Merge pull request #179 from ronnyws/master
Expand the pattern rule for the three common tests.
|
2019-06-03 08:25:23 -04:00 |
|
Matthias J. Kannwischer
|
8d39f6ba8c
|
Merge pull request #180 from sebastianv89/patch-1
Fixed link to rust project in README.md
|
2019-06-01 11:29:17 +02:00 |
|
Sebastian
|
6ad7937b5e
|
Fixed link to rust project in README.md
|
2019-05-30 17:09:53 -04:00 |
|
Ronny Wichers Schreur
|
69e00a5b7f
|
Expand the pattern rule for the three common tests.
Fixes https://github.com/PQClean/PQClean/issues/178.
|
2019-05-29 15:10:11 +02:00 |
|
Leon
|
b320752f2a
|
fix more msvc warnings
|
2019-05-27 23:58:49 +02:00 |
|
Leon
|
ca6d935bbc
|
fix msvc warnings
|
2019-05-27 22:48:15 +02:00 |
|
Leon
|
7b9e254a8b
|
fix reading outside buffer
|
2019-05-27 20:21:05 +02:00 |
|
Leon
|
a7b3aa73b2
|
fix gcc/clang-tidy warnings, remove preprocessor conditionals
|
2019-05-27 20:17:53 +02:00 |
|
Leon
|
1680f3f125
|
add nmake makefile
|
2019-05-27 19:16:31 +02:00 |
|
Leon
|
cc551546bf
|
cleaning & fixing gcc warnings
|
2019-05-24 18:38:54 +02:00 |
|
Douglas Stebila
|
9a82706697
|
Merge pull request #176 from PQClean/frodoopt
Add optimized FrodoKEM
|
2019-05-22 11:45:20 +02:00 |
|
Matthias J. Kannwischer
|
c7c080568e
|
add opt versions of frodokem976aes, frodokem976shake, frodokem1344aes, frodokem1344shake and the corresponding duplicate checks
|
2019-05-22 07:42:43 +02:00 |
|
Matthias J. Kannwischer
|
743b28f7a8
|
make VS compiler happy in matrix_aes.c
|
2019-05-22 07:31:03 +02:00 |
|
Joost Rijneveld
|
2244735a87
|
Merge pull request #175 from PQClean/hash_state_struct
Use opaque structs for the hashing API
|
2019-05-21 17:03:50 +02:00 |
|
Joost Rijneveld
|
cb39f46854
|
Merge pull request #177 from PQClean/fix-166
Add -Wredundant-decls
|
2019-05-21 17:02:58 +02:00 |
|
Matthias J. Kannwischer
|
901761d88a
|
make VS compiler happy in matrix_shake.c
|
2019-05-21 16:22:09 +02:00 |
|
Matthias J. Kannwischer
|
df4319c47f
|
add duplicate consistency check
|
2019-05-21 15:58:20 +02:00 |
|
Matthias J. Kannwischer
|
57ad79ae3a
|
remove preprocessor conditionals from frodokem640shake
|
2019-05-21 15:51:56 +02:00 |
|
Matthias J. Kannwischer
|
cf8e4e5179
|
add optimized frodokem640aes
|
2019-05-21 15:46:59 +02:00 |
|
Matthias J. Kannwischer
|
7701666093
|
remove OPENSSL preprocessor conditionals
|
2019-05-21 15:17:57 +02:00 |
|
Matthias J. Kannwischer
|
081442bb8d
|
use more recent version of the code
|
2019-05-21 15:15:52 +02:00 |
|
Thom Wiggers
|
199adb8072
|
Add -Wredundant-decls
|
2019-05-20 16:12:01 +02:00 |
|
Matthias J. Kannwischer
|
a4906713be
|
use optimized matrix_shake.c for frodokem640shake
|
2019-05-20 15:12:51 +02:00 |
|
Thom Wiggers
|
0e73f2dda2
|
Use opaque fips202 structs in MQDSS
|
2019-05-20 10:52:28 +02:00 |
|